Liver injury is major health problems about more than 900 drugs implicated in case of liver injury. Hepatotoxicity is caused by the alcoholic consumption, toxic substances and certain drugs which produce injury to liver such as thioacetamide, paracetamol, anti-tubercular drugs, chemotherapeutic agents and some of organic and inorganic compounds. Medicinal plants are the significant source of hepatoprotective drugs. Mono and poly-herbal preparations have been used in various liver disorders
